What does a phased array do?

A phased array is a device used in radar, sonar, and communication systems to steer and shape beams electronically without moving parts. It consists of multiple antenna elements whose signals are combined with specific phase differences to direct the signal in desired directions, enabling rapid beam steering and improved target detection or data transmission. What are some typical challenges faced by Phased Array Engineers on the job?

Phased Array Engineers commonly face challenges related to the complexity of antenna design, such as optimizing performance while managing size, cost, and power constraints. They often collaborate with multidisciplinary teams—working closely with hardware, software, and systems engineers—to integrate their arrays into larger systems. Daily tasks may involve troubleshooting unwanted signal interference or ensuring synchronization across multiple channels. Overcoming these hurdles requires both technical expertise and strong communication to deliver reliable, high-performance phased array solutions.

What is a phased array in NDT?

A phased array in nondestructive testing (NDT) is an ultrasonic testing technique that uses multiple transducer elements to steer, focus, and scan ultrasonic beams electronically. This allows for rapid, precise inspection of materials and components, often requiring specialized training and equipment. Phased array techniques improve defect detection and characterization in complex geometries.

Amazon.com, Inc., commonly known as Amazon, is an American multinational technology company. It was founded by Jeff Bezos in 1994 and initially started as an online marketplace for books. Since then, Amazon has expanded its operations and become one of the largest e-commerce companies in the world. Amazon's primary business is its online retail platform, where customers can purchase a vast array of products, including electronics, clothing, books, home goods, and much more. The company offers a convenient and user-friendly shopping experience, with features such as fast shipping, customer reviews, and personalized recommendations. In addition to its e-commerce platform, Amazon has diversified its business into various other areas. One of its notable ventures is Amazon Web Services (AWS), a comprehensive cloud computing platform that provides services such as storage, compute power, and database management to individuals and businesses. AWS has become a leader in the cloud computing industry, powering many websites and applications worldwide. Amazon has also developed its own consumer electronics, including the popular Amazon Kindle e-reader, Fire tablets, Fire TV streaming devices, and the Alexa-powered Echo smart speakers. The Alexa voice assistant, integrated into these devices, allows users to interact with their devices using voice commands, perform tasks, and access information. Furthermore, Amazon has expanded into media and entertainment. It operates Prime Video, a streaming service that offers a wide range of movies, TV shows, and original content. Amazon Music provides a platform for streaming and purchasing digital music, while Audible offers audiobooks and other audio content. The company's commitment to customer satisfaction and convenience is demonstrated by its membership program, Amazon Prime. Prime members receive various benefits, including free two-day shipping, access to streaming services, exclusive deals, and more.
